The advanced yet simple-to-use PowerShot SX400 IS gets you up close from virtually anywhere with a 30x Optical Zoom and 24mm Wide-Angle lens with Optical Image Stabilizer for beautiful clarity. Give your images and video what they’ve been missing: zoom in on your child’s face in a crowd, capture action from up in the stands, or a pet’s most playful moments. In addition to this impressive versatility, PowerShot SX400 IS offers incredible Canon image quality, with a 16.0 Megapixel sensor and the Canon DIGIC 4+ Image Processor for richly detailed, brilliant images and true-to-life 720p HD video. The camera makes it easy to get your best shot every time, with Intelligent IS for shake-free images, High Speed AF for effortless shooting, and Smart AUTO that automatically chooses the proper camera settings for the shooting situation.
